Bike tour: Weißpriach
35 km in length
Of special interest for cyclist are the 35 km long bicycle Speiche Weißpriach route (round trip) in Mariapfarr, approx. 270 m in altitude or the 20 km Speiche Lignitz route, approx. 500 m in altitude.
Mountain biking
in the Lungau holiday region
The Pirka-Fanning route, a challenging 28,4 km mountain bike route starts right in Mariapfarr and goes from 1.075 to 1.480 m above sea level. From nearby Mauterndorf, Tamsweg or St. Michael there are also many mountain bike tours of varied difficulty.

E-bikes
for gentle cycling
The Lungau holiday region is also a pioneer in the field of E-Bikes - there are 71 free E-Bike charging stations! E-Bikes are powered by an engine that supports the natural running motion so you can travel longer on more challenging routes.

Please note:
If you are out and about on forest roads with your mountain bike, please observe the following rules:
- Travel times: 01.06.-15.09. between 9 a.m. and 7 p.m. & 16.09.-31.10. between 9 a.m. and 5 p.m.
- Please drive only on designated routes.
- Since there is also work in the forest areas, please pay attention to lying wood, grazing cattle and vehicles.
- Choose routes that suit your technical ability.
- Also pay attention to the equipment of your bicycle prescribed by the StVO and in particular to the helmet obligation for children under the age of 12.
